Behind The Lens

Location

Iceland

Time

around midday

Lighting

no extra light. only natural sunlight though it was kinda heavily cloudy yet this added to the idea i had in mind

Equipment

panasonic fz-30 (a bridge camera).

Inspiration

we had been to iceland in june which is supposed to be summer. yet in this golden circle trip, it was getting colder and more cloudy the further we go. as we arrived to the glacier walk spot it was already too cold, too windy and kinda heavily cloudy.. the view was very beautiful though with the different colors of the icy berg yet i wanted so much to find a shot that expresses the general atmosphere. this harsh, cold and kinda unwelcoming strong wind. as we got in the boat having our trip between the melting ice berg i took couple of pics and was trying to compose this harsh pic i had in mind till i found this ice berg. for a moment i could imagine it as a giant flying beast from an old legend. so i decided to have it like that in the pic..i took my spot beside the edge of the boat and kept watching it in my viewfinder as the boat is moving till i got my correct angle and snapped the pic.

Editing

some shake reduction to counteract shaking from boat movement and handheld shaking of the camera. i also adjusted brightness and contrast.

In my camera bag

now i don't use this camera anymore. i have a canon 7d with 15-85mm zoom lens. 50 and 24 primes. a tripod. different sized filters from hoya..recently obtained a second hand set of filters from cokin. an extra battery.
